3 out of 5 stars Ponderous, Slow and Humongous   March 30, 2008
 3 out of 3 found this review helpful

This program takes up almost 1/2 Gig on my drive. It takes a looong time to open.

It is very slow to start, and it offers TOO many choices.

I want to use it with my PayPal Account, my eBay sales and my other sales, and in some cases, it does a very good job, such as in creating categories, accounts and customer data.

BUT it lost an invoice twice already. It was VERY hard to FIND that lost invoice -- and when I printed that invoice (which was a very basic invoice), it truncated.

I expect more from Microsoft. That said, I will use this software for just the basics, as it slows me down and is not as user friendly as it should be.

5 out of 5 stars Move Over Peachtree - There is a New Boss in Town   March 27, 2008
 3 out of 3 found this review helpful

As someone who has used Peachtree for my small business accounting needs for years I always felt that while Peachtree was a good program, it was far too comlicated and bloated for the average small business user. I wanted something that, quite frankly, made doing my books a snap -- as easy as writing a letter -- and I found it with Microsoft Accounting Professional 2008.

First off, let me state this -- if you are an average user of the Microsoft Office suite of products then Accounting 2008 is going to be a snap for you to use. They have went to great lengths to make sure you don't need an Accounting degree to understand it. A lot of the features not only integrate extremely well with Office 2007, but will remind you a lot of using Office (minus the ribbon interface).

One of the really nice features of Accounting is the ability to add third-party add-ins. Out of the box you get an integration module for Paypal, so your invoices can automatically generate Paypal requests and Accounting can automatically classify and deduct the fees for it from the appropriate accounts. As your business grows, and you decide that you need to do direct credit card processing, Accounting 2008 lets you integrate with CC processors directly -- again, handling managing the costs and fees for you.

Dashboards are another strong feature of this product. How is my business doing? What is my accounts payable looking like? How much cash do I have on hand? All that information and more is available through quick, convenient dashboards. You can drill down into the dashboards to pull up reports to see more detailed data.

If you use Business Contact Manager for Outlook then you are in for a treat -- it integrates directly with Accounting to help you track not only customer information, but also communications and marketing camapaigns! No more having to hunt and search for emails sent months ago or wondering if your marketing campaigns via e-mail are working.

All in all, I couldn't be happier with the product. I think it has been a welcome upgrade from Peachtree and thanks to its integration with other products really brings my business into a 360-view. I know immediately how well things are doing, what my customers are up to, and what needs my attention.

If you own a small business then do yourself a favor and give this a try. I think you will be pleasantly surprised.



3 out of 5 stars Slow and difficult software   March 21, 2008
 1 out of 3 found this review helpful

I purchased this product to be mainly used for my father's small business. I used Microsoft money and Quickbook and I wanted to try the new Microsoft accoutning software.

The Pros:
1) Paypal integration
2) Can convert Quickbook documents

The Cons:
1) Too slow (in terms of conversion) and often there are missing data
2) Too many features (overwhelming)

I felt that the bad cons outweighed the good and in this case, I'd give it a 3 star.



4 out of 5 stars I'm not an accountant   March 21, 2008
 1 out of 3 found this review helpful

I'm not an accountant. So I feel I am not able to really evaluate this program fully.

I did find I could use the expense tracking part well (and this was helpful as my previous way to track out of pocket business expenses was discontinued.) And this works well with Outlook (you can export information about contacts to the accounting module here) so if I had billing on my own to do, I could possibly send out invoices based on client or customer information in Outlook. For that reason, I really like this software because that saves a lot of time. But as a non-professional in the field of accounting, I don't think I can give a more in-depth analysis of whether this is superior to other accounting packages ( Quickbooks Pro for an example. )

And personally, I prefer to use a professional accountant for these tasks. But if you are setting up your own business and intend to keep your own books, or if you have a lot of business expenses and want to have something to send to your accountant, this is very helpful software.
